The Design Of Special Laser Cutting System Based On PA8000

Laser cutting in various areas of processing, owes a wide range of applications. Laser cutting contains narrow kerf, small heat treating of metals deformation, high precision, high speed and low pollution, high efficiency, good flexibility, wide application range and low noise. At present, CNC laser cutting machine demand is growing.The market is potential and has a very impressive prospect. Laser cutting numerical control system is devoted to achieve localization of laser equipment and meet the integration, automation, digital control and other requirements, while responding to social requirements of sustainable development. The problem with that is designed to transmit by Ethernet bus is to solve the traditional laser cutting machine complicated signal line, anti-interference ability, short transmission distance and other shortcomings. On PA8000LW(Milling Version) to develop a laser cutting special edition, laser cutting CNC system is networked, intelligent and a new attempt.PA(Power Automation) CNC system is a fully software-based CNC.Based on Windows XP system, it owes good stability and openness, so it attracted more attention. The good and the bad of laser cutting quality depends on the following aspects: mechanical system rigidity, the servo motor in response to the pace, the material thickness, the cutting speed, real-time laser output power, laser focus position, the defocus amount, and the auxiliary gas pressure.The paper does a brief introduction about the architecture and a variety of interfaces of PA system. The design focuses on three aspects: Laser cutting CNC system man-machine interface development and Motion Control software and PLC software development, Research of cutting process parameters, The motor response to the influence of a workpiece.
